Since its completion in 1931, Down  rough the Canyon has had only two owners, both prominent artists of national importance—the painter Norman Rockwell and the actor Carroll O’Connor, known to many as the TV personality Archie Bunker. O’Connor’s widow, Nancy, bequeathed the painting to her brother, John Fields.
 is painting was a late wedding gift to Norman and Mary Barstow Rockwell; the couple married on April 17, 1930, in Alhambra, California, but the painting is dated 1931, so at least seven or eight months had passed between the couple’s wedding day and the Johnsons’ gift.  e inscription on the back reads, “Painted expressly for Norman and Mary Rockwell,” and indicates that both Johnson and his wife Vinnie gave the painting to the newlyweds. It appears that both Johnson and Rockwell were pleased with the painting.
 e Johnsons and the Rockwells were close neighbors in Alhambra, and they often visited each other in their respective studios. It may even have been in Rockwell’s studio that Johnson became inspired with the painting’s subject. In the months leading up to the Rockwell wedding, Norman was busy with a commission from  e Saturday Evening Post. His model was actor Gary Cooper, who was volunteered for the job by Paramount Studios, which had just produced  e Texan, in which
he starred. Cooper was already a high pro le Western movie star because of his leading role in  e Virginian, which had premiered in November 1929.  ere is speculation that the appearance in the neighborhood of a celebrated Hollywood movie star like Cooper may have been in e ect memorialized in Johnson’s Down  rough the Canyon, but via the dramatic nocturnal depiction of Indians rather than cowboys.
